Transaction efbae732cb85d795f090d9094b5aa8b2e2f9b38d66bcaf1e145fc1053d2f5199
1 Input
2 Outputs
- efbae732cb85d795f090d9094b5aa8b2e2f9b38d66bcaf1e145fc1053d2f5199:0
- efbae732cb85d795f090d9094b5aa8b2e2f9b38d66bcaf1e145fc1053d2f5199:1
value 5376961784
address 1DxxWkADJGVR71BvfyFM5bsia26MceeM26
value 1452631455
address 121bAbS3GSLVY3am4NrAnXAfJpMjWFGT5v